@keyframes tonext{75%{left:0}95%{left:100%}98%{left:100%}99%{left:0}}@keyframes tostart{75%{left:0}95%{left:-300%}98%{left:-300%}99%{left:0}}@keyframes snap{96%{scroll-snap-align:center}97%{scroll-snap-align:none}99%{scroll-snap-align:none}to{scroll-snap-align:center}}.bundle-and-save{margin-top:40px}.bundle-and-save section{background-color:#1e272c;padding:2rem 0;max-width:1200px;margin:0 auto}.bundle-and-save section .section-title{margin-bottom:3rem;font-size:28px;font-weight:900;text-align:center;text-transform:uppercase;color:#fff}@media (min-width: 425px){.bundle-and-save section .section-title{font-size:40px}}.bundle-and-save section .inner-container .bundle-product{position:relative;width:100%}.bundle-and-save section .inner-container .bundle-product .inner-bundle{padding:2rem;background-color:#fff;border-radius:17px;margin:0 1rem}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container{display:flex;justify-content:flex-start;flex-direction:column;margin-top:20px;height:292px;text-align:left}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container h3{margin:0;font-size:18px;font-weight:700;text-transform:uppercase}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.bundle-price{margin:0}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.bundle-price span .price{font-size:20px;color:#2b996d}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.bundle-price span .compare-at-price{font-size:15px;color:#8c8b8b}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.short-description{font-size:12px}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.short-description p{margin:0}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.buttons{margin:auto 0 0;display:flex;justify-content:space-between;flex-wrap:wrap}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.buttons .global-button{margin-bottom:8px;width:100%}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.buttons .global-button:last-of-type{margin-bottom:0}@media screen and (min-width: 1391px){.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.buttons{flex-wrap:unset}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.buttons .global-button{margin:0;padding:12px;font-size:11px}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.buttons .add-to-cart{margin-right:8px}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.buttons .learn-more{margin-left:8px}}@media screen and (min-width: 1024px){.bundle-and-save section .inner-container{display:flex;justify-content:center;flex-wrap:wrap;max-width:1200px;margin:0 auto}.bundle-and-save section .inner-container .bundle-product{flex:unset;width:calc((100% / 3) - 2rem);margin:0 1rem}.bundle-and-save section .inner-container .bundle-product .inner-bundle{margin:0}}@media screen and (min-width: 1391px){.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container{height:180px}.bundle-and-save section .inner-container .bundle-product .inner-bundle .info-container .buttons{margin:auto 0 0}}.bundle-and-save section .inner-container.slick-initialized .slick-dots{display:flex;justify-content:space-between;margin:2rem auto 0;padding:0;max-width:75px;width:100%}.bundle-and-save section .inner-container.slick-initialized .slick-dots li{list-style:none;cursor:pointer}.bundle-and-save section .inner-container.slick-initialized .slick-dots li i{display:inline-block;width:16px;height:16px;background-color:#fff;border-radius:50%}.bundle-and-save section .inner-container.slick-initialized .slick-dots li.slick-active i{background-color:#2a996c}.bundle-and-save section .inner-container.slick-initialized .slick-dots li:hover i{background-color:#2a996c}@media screen and (min-width: 426px){.bundle-and-save section{padding:4rem 2rem}}@media screen and (min-width: 769px){.bundle-and-save section{padding:4rem 6rem}}
/*# sourceMappingURL=/cdn/shop/t/212/assets/bundle-and-save.css.map */
